Affiliated Managers Group (NYSE:AMG -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, July 30th. The asset manager reported $8.29 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$7.90 by $0.39. The company had revenue of $640.70 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$590.94 million. Affiliated Managers Group had a return on equity of 21.94% and a net margin of 37.72%.The company's revenue was up .0%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$5.39 earnings per share. Equities analysts forecast that Affiliated Managers Group, Inc. will post 36.69 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Affiliated Managers Group, Inc NYSE: AMG is a global asset management holding company that partners with boutique investment firms. Founded in 1993 and headquartered in West Palm Beach, Florida, AMG invests in and collaborates with independent investment managers to foster growth while preserving their entrepreneurial culture. Through equity stakes and strategic support, the company aims to enhance its affiliates' distribution capabilities, operational infrastructure and access to capital.

The company's core business activities include providing capital solutions, distribution services and operational support to affiliated investment firms.
